1-Wire EEPROM in a three-pin TO-92
The Maxim DS28E07+ is a 1Kbit serial EEPROM that communicates over a single-contact 1-Wire interface, needing only one data line and a ground return to transfer data to a host microcontroller. Organized as 256 x 4 bits, it stores small configuration parameters, calibration constants, or serialisation data in a non-volatile array. The 2 µs access time keeps read cycles tight enough that a typical MCU polling the bus does not need extra wait states. Supply range spans 3V to 5.25V, covering both 3.3V and 5V logic rails without a level translator.
Through-hole footprint, industrial temperature range
The DS28E07+ comes in a TO-92-3 through-hole package (TO-226-3, TO-92-3 (TO-226AA)), the same three-lead outline used by many small-signal transistors and temperature sensors. It drops into a standard 0.1-inch pitch PCB footprint with no reflow profile needed — hand-solder or wave-solder friendly. The operating temperature range of -40°C to +85°C qualifies it for industrial environments, outdoor telecom cabinets, and factory-floor sensor nodes where commercial-grade parts drift out of spec.
